Excessive optical cable loss can result from fiber attenuation, dirty or misaligned connectors, splices, or improper installation, and can be diagnosed and mitigated using loss budget calculations and proper testing techniques.Understanding Optical Cable LossOptical cable loss, or attenuation, is the reduction in signal strength as light travels through a fiber optic cable. It occurs due to intrinsic absorption by the fiber material, scattering (mainly Rayleigh scattering), and extrinsic factors such as impurities, bends, splices, and connectors . Single-mode fibers typically have lower attenuation (0.4–0.5 dB/km at 1310–1550 nm), while multimode fibers experience higher loss (around 3 dB/km at 850 nm), . Excessive loss can prevent the receiver from detecting the signal correctly, limiting transmission distance and network performance .Common Causes of High LossDirty or damaged connectors: Dust, scratches, or improper seating can add 0.2–0.5 dB per connector .Excessive splices or poor splicing: Each splice introduces 0.15–0.3 dB loss depending on the fiber type and method .Tight bends or stress on the fiber: Bending below the minimum radius causes light leakage and increased attenuation .Low-quality fiber or components: Cheap or defective fiber, patch panels, or splitters can increase insertion loss .Intrinsic material absorption: Impurities in silica or molecular vibrations in the infrared band can absorb light energy .Measuring and Diagnosing LossOptical Loss Test Set (OLTS) or optical power meters are used to measure insertion loss between two points .Loss budget calculation: Sum the expected losses from fiber, connectors, splices, and passive components to determine acceptable limits.
